Technical Specifications

ParameterValue
CAS Number84163-77-9
Molecular FormulaC12H13FN2O
Molecular Weight220.243 g/mol
AppearanceAlmost white to yellow powder
Assay (HPLC)≥98.0% - 102.0%
Melting Point59-62 °C
Boiling Point359.0±42.0 °C at 760 mmHg
Density1.2±0.1 g/cm3
Flash Point170.9±27.9 °C
Residue on Ignition≤0.5%
Total Impurities≤1.0%

Industrial Applications

This compound serves primarily as a vital intermediate in the pharmaceutical industry. It is specifically utilized in the synthetic pathways leading to certain antipsychotic medications. The high purity level ensures minimal side reactions during coupling steps, thereby improving overall yield and reducing purification burdens in later stages. Beyond its primary use, the chemical structure offers potential for exploration in medicinal chemistry research where benzisoxazole derivatives are required.
